Grasshopper's next Blu-ray release (with absolutely no fanfare) is Sky Hopinka's Małni - Towards the Ocean, Towards the Shore, coming out on October 21. This is the film I most regret not being able to see in a theater last year, so I'm very happy it's at least getting the Blu treatment. Special features are scant, but they include my favorite of his short films, Fainting Spells.

In more baffling news, Grasshopper have seemingly acquired Sion Sono's Red Post on Escher Street--again, without any publicity whatsoever--but will only make it available in virtual cinemas (starting tomorrow), with a DVD release to follow on December 14.

Grasshopper is giving a lot of love to their release of Tsai's Days

Pre-order: https://grasshopperfilm.myshopify.com/p ... ys-blu-ray
PLEASE NOTE: THIS TITLE IS AVAILABLE FOR PRE-ORDER. IT IS NOT ELIGIBLE FOR THE HOLIDAY SALE DISCOUNT BUT SHIPPING FOR THIS ITEM IS FREE WHEN COMBINED WITH OTHER HOLIDAY ORDERS. SHIPS 1/25/22.
BLU-RAY DISC ONE

• Days (2020, 127 minutes), a film by Tsai Ming-liang
• Press Conference with Tsai Ming-liang, Lee Kang-sheng and Anong Houngheuangsy following the world premiere of Days at the 2020 Berlinale (33 minutes)
• U.S. Theatrical Trailer

BLU-RAY DISC TWO

• Afternoon (2015, 137 minutes), a feature documentary by Tsai Ming-liang with actor Lee Kang-sheng
• Wandering (2021, 34 minutes), a new short film by Tsai Ming-liang
• New video interview with director Tsai Ming-liang (30 minutes)
• “Director Tsai’s Cafe Gallerie,” an image gallery featuring exhibition posters and photographs from the Taiwanese cinema operated by Tsai Ming-liang between 2011 and 2014

Plus, a limited edition slipcase with alternate black & white poster art (1000 print run only)
